Vancouver Coastal Health is looking for an Executive Director Quality Safety & Patient Experience to join the team.
Reporting to the dyad leadership of the Vice President Professional Practice and the Vice President Medicine and Academic Affairs the Executive Director provides senior executive leadership for Vancouver Coastal Healths (VCH) enterprise-wide quality patient safety infection prevention and control (IPAC) and patient experience portfolio.
This role leads the strategic planning development integration and transformation of quality and safety initiatives across VCH including oversight of:
Working within VCHs dyad leadership framework the Executive Director collaborates closely with medical quality leadership to integrate clinical and medical standards of care surgical quality change management accreditation epidemiology engagement data analytics and performance measurement into a cohesive system-wide approach.
The Executive Director champions a culture of continuous quality improvement and patient safety ensuring measurable reductions in adverse events and meaningful improvements in care experiences for patients and families.

As per Ministry of Health policy all health care workers working in publicly-funded health care facilities are required to report their past receipt of certain vaccines or history of certain infections. Collecting these records will allow for offering of any missing vaccines and for appropriate actions to be taken in the event of any future exposure to a communicable disease or during outbreaks. For all new hires and appointments to Vancouver Coastal Health you will be asked to provide this information as part of the onboarding process.
